Start with Your Family

7/6/2009

What values did you learn in your home? Did you learn honesty? What about taking care of each other?  Did your mom and dad teach you to have good table manners? To complete a task? To Work hard? Whether it was done intentionally or not, all of us learn from our own parents certain values. Some parents are excellent teachers of values. Some just hope that their kids will pick up on them. Children though are like sponges and they will absorb anything that is going on in their home. And if you behave in respectful ways with your spouse, your children, your friends, your children will learn this value from you. That this is the way to treat others. You CAN teach, train and model good healthy values for your children. Even if you didn’t have a childhood where your parents taught you, you can do more. You can do better. Become today, the loving, respectful and involved parent that your child needs and deserves. Create a good life for your child. A better life perhaps than the one that you had. God does give you chance to have a fresh start --with your own family.
